Guadalajara, Mexico | "Boku Restaurant and Bar"

[Award Details] A’ Design Award & Competition 2026 SILVER Award

"Boku Restaurant and Bar" in Guadalajara, Mexico, received the SILVER Award at the A’ Design Award, recognizing its high creativity and perfection in spatial design.

The contrast between brick and bamboo creates a sophisticated atmosphere. The main counter promises an extraordinary experience.

This project fuses Japanese spatial composition concepts with Mexican local culture. Inspired by Osaka's street food culture, it constructs a unique spatial experience with takoyaki as the central concept.

The back bar lined with carefully selected bottles, and delicate wood carvings. The impressive octopus art wall symbolizes the brand concept on the main floor.

This area, where art and design merge, creates a dramatic night.

In terms of spatial design, curved forms are used to create movement and flow, intending to foster an environment where natural communication can occur. Additionally, textured finishes and natural materials are employed on the walls to add depth and warmth to the space.

Furthermore, the lighting plan utilizing bamboo materials creates a soft ambiance, and the mezzanine level, leveraging the double-height structure, achieves a three-dimensional and functional spatial composition.

Manila, Philippines | "+81 Bar & Club"

[Award Details] A’ Design Award & Competition 2026 Bronze Award

"+81 Bar & Club" in Manila, Philippines, received the Bronze Award at the A’ Design Award, recognizing its high creativity and perfection in spatial design.

The main bar counter, characterized by its curved ceiling design and lighting effects, is designed to embody the world of "Neo Tokyo."

This project is a hidden nightlife space with a "Neo Tokyo" concept, planned within an existing shopping mall in Manila, Philippines. The exterior is designed to resemble a temporary construction site, blending in with its surroundings to create an experience of entering a secret space.

Beyond the entrance, designed to resemble a toy shop, the bar space unfolds through a hidden door. Neon effects and reflective materials are used to create an immersive spatial experience.

A live painting created by artist "GOSPEL" on the pre-opening day. The circulation design, reminiscent of a secret base, enhances the sense of the extraordinary.
